AC Milan Falls to Sassuolo 0-2, Third Place at Risk

📋 Key Takeaway: AC Milan suffered a 0-2 defeat against Sassuolo, putting their third-place position in Serie A at risk as Juventus threatens to overtake them.

Match Overview

On Sunday, AC Milan faced a challenging match against Sassuolo in the 35th round of Serie A, ultimately falling 0-2. The defeat has put Milan’s third-place standing in jeopardy as they now sit just three points ahead of fourth-placed Juventus, who are set to play later against Verona. This loss could have significant implications for Milan’s Champions League aspirations.

Sassuolo’s victory was propelled by early and late goals from Domenico Berardi in the fifth minute and French forward Armand Laurienté in the 47th minute. The match took a decisive turn for Milan when defender Fikayo Tomori was sent off in the 24th minute after receiving a second yellow card, leaving the team to compete with ten players for the majority of the match.

Implications for the Teams

With this defeat, Milan’s points total remains at 67, a precarious position as they face increasing pressure from Juventus, who could capitalize on this slip-up with a win against Verona. The loss also marks a critical moment in the season for Milan, which has shown inconsistencies in performance, raising concerns among fans and analysts alike regarding their ability to secure a Champions League spot.

Conversely, Sassuolo’s win elevates them to ninth place in the standings, with a total of 49 points.
